ML2 Cisco Nexus MD: Access host ID via port-binding

Bug #1220878 reported by Rich Curran
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
neutron
Fix Released
High
Rich Curran

Bug Description

The Cisco Nexus ML2 mechanism driver code accesses the host ID via a call to the Nova client.
The port-binding blueprint (https://review.openstack.org/#/c/43129) allows for access to the host ID.
Once this BP is merged then this call to the nova client can be removed and replaced with direct port-binding access code.

Tags: cisco
Rich Curran (rcurran)
summary: - Access host ID via port-binding
+ ML2 Cisco Nexus MD: Access host ID via port-binding
Revision history for this message
Robert Kukura (rkukura) wrote :

Also, since ml2-portbinding could bind any of the segments in a multi-segment network, port_context.bound_segment should be used instead of port_context.network.network_segments[0].

Changed in neutron:
importance: Undecided → High
milestone: none → havana-3
assignee: nobody → Rich Curran (rcurran)
Changed in neutron:
milestone: havana-3 → havana-rc1
Changed in neutron:
status: New → Triaged
tags: added: cisco havana-rc-potential
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to neutron (master)

Fix proposed to branch: master
Review: https://review.openstack.org/48686

Changed in neutron:
status: Triaged →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to neutron (master)

Reviewed: https://review.openstack.org/48686
Committed: http://github.com/openstack/neutron/commit/6925bd7e00d5c39d20450bcf41e848435b6d9830
Submitter: Jenkins
Branch: master

commit 6925bd7e00d5c39d20450bcf41e848435b6d9830
Author: Rich Curran <email address hidden>
Date: Fri Sep 27 11:35:08 2013 -0400

    ML2 Cisco Nexus mech driver portbinding support

    This commit adds portbinding extension support to
    the cisco nexus mechanism driver.

    Fixes bug: 1220878

    Change-Id: I72003961b46190b82681b471f4f9cb5b11d3d068

Changed in neutron:
status: In Progress → Fix Committed
tags: removed: havana-rc-potential
Thierry Carrez (ttx)
Changed in neutron:
status: Fix Committed → Fix Released
Thierry Carrez (ttx)
Changed in neutron:
milestone: havana-rc1 → 2013.2
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.